What are the x– and y–intercepts of the quadratic equation y = 2x2 – 8x + 6? Answer x–intercepts: (–3, 0) and (–1, 0) y–intercept: (0, 6) x–intercepts: (–3, 0) and (–1, 0) y–intercept: (0, 3) x–intercepts: (–3, 0) and (–1, 0) y–intercept: (0, 3) x–intercepts: (3, 0) and (1, 0) y–intercept: (0, 6)

OpenStudy (anonymous):

x-intercepts occur where y = 0. 0 = 2x² - 8x + 6 0 = 2(x² - 4x + 3) 0 = 2(x - 3)(x - 1) x - 3 = 0 and x - 1 = 0 x = {3,1}
